U.S.26 traffic stop yields guns, machete, rum, clown mask
Three men were under arrest after a traffic stop on U.S. 26 yielded two handguns, marijuana, five knives, a machete, stun gun, handcuffs, a bail bondsman badge, an open container of Captain Morgan rum and one clown mask.
Two troopers pulled over the eastbound car near Brightwood Friday afternoon after motorists called 9-1-1 to report that men inside a car were flashing a police badge to get through traffic. The car was a 1999 police model Ford Crown Victoria with Washington plates.
Police also found Washington bail bond badge in the car.
Driver Joseph H. Maillous, 55, was cited for unlawful possession of a firearm and open container of alcohol in a vehicle. Passenger Daniel J. Tighe, 31, was cited for unlawful possession of a firearm. A second, unnamed passenger was cited for possession of less than an ounce of marijuana and failure to use safety restraints.
